         <title>Atmosphere</title>
         <author>scompt0371</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/scompt0371/iu7uv4hs4e9s/wish/200048355</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>The moon has a very weak atmosphere, called an exosphere. It does not have any protection from the sun's radiation or impacts from meteors.</div>]]></description>

         <title>Light</title>
         <author>scompt0371</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/scompt0371/iu7uv4hs4e9s/wish/200438630</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>The moon shines because its surface reflects light from the sun. And despite the fact that the moon seems to shine very brightly, it only reflects 3 to 12 percent of the suns light.</div>]]></description>

         <title>Location</title>
         <author>scompt0371</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/scompt0371/iu7uv4hs4e9s/wish/200443980</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>The moon is farther away than you think. It is 238,855 miles (384,400 kilometers) away from earth</div>]]></description>

         <title>Movement</title>
         <author>scompt0371</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/scompt0371/iu7uv4hs4e9s/wish/200834604</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>The moon is orbiting around the earth. It takes 27 days for the moon to orbit completely around the earth. To us the moon seems to orbit us every 29 days.</div>]]></description>
